Friday, 14 July 2017

Microsoft is Giving Away Millions of FREE eBooks

Microsoft’s Director of Sales Excellence, Eric Ligman is running the largest ever FREE Microsoft eBook Giveaway.  In his blog post of the 11th July Eric says:

“I’m Giving Away MILLIONS of FREE Microsoft eBooks again, including: Windows 10, Office 365, Office 2016, Power BI, Azure, Windows 8.1, Office 2013, SharePoint 2016, SharePoint 2013, Dynamics CRM, PowerShell, Exchange Server, System Center, Cloud, SQL Server and more!” 

The eBooks are completely FREE ! with no catch and provides a great opportunity to learn some great Microsoft subjects.

These eBooks are available in several formats so you should be able to find something that you are interested in that works with your reader of choice.

I encourage you to pop along to Eric's blog and get hold of as many eBooks as take your fancy.... also you can follow Eric on twitter.

Happy reading.

Thursday, 6 July 2017

Nutanix - How to Delete an uploaded Image Service File

I have recently started using Nutanix CE in my Home Lab and can say that I am really liking the product. 

I currently have a single node running on an Intel NUC (NUC6i3SYH). While this current setup is not that powerful and doesn't provide any failover capability, it does provide a nice cheap way to test and have a good play around with the Nutanix features and functionality.

Recently I have been using the Image Service to upload a few ISO images that I want to be able to mount to my VM's. One issue that I came across was that while part way through an image upload I had a network outage..... this resulted in the image partially uploading and left me with no ability to delete the partial image from within the Prism web interface.

To resolve this issue I made an ssh connection to the CVM, then changed into the Acropolis CLI by typing acli...... to see what images the Image Service knows about type image.list

To delete the partial ISO image just type image.delete <Image UUID>

Checking back in Prism or typing image.list in the acli again will show that the selected image file has now been deleted.

Tuesday, 20 June 2017

NSClient++ - Check McAfee Status

I wanted to have Nagios monitor the status of McAfee Virus-Scan on our servers. I wanted to ensure that I knew of any installations where the Agent, Virus-Scan, Engine or DATs were not at a version that they should be.
To that end I decided to write a bit of PowerShell code to use in conjunction with NSClient++ that we use for monitoring our Windows servers.
You can download the PowerShell script from GitHub here:-

Put the downloaded script into your scripts folder in your NSClient++ installation location... e.g.:-

“C:\Program Files\NSClient++\scripts”

The PowerShell script will check registry keys for McAfee based on the following parameters which need to be supplied:-


If the values of the supplied parameters do not match then a Warning or Critical level will be raised back to Nagios.

To execute from within NSClient++ the following should be in the NSClient++.ini file:-

[NRPE Handlers]
check_mcafee_status = cmd /c echo scripts\Check_McAfee_Status.ps1 -AgentVersion -VScanVersion -EngineVersion 5800.7501 -WarnDays 2 -CritDays 5; exit($lastexitcode) | powershell.exe -command –

The bold numbers above should be changed to match your requirements.

On the check_nrpe command include the -t 60, since it can take longer than the standard 10 seconds to run.

I have tested this with the following x86 & x64 versions of NSClient++ version
NSClient++ version on the below Operating Systems.

Windows Server 2003
Windows Server 2003 R2
Windows Server 2008
Windows Server 2008 R2
Windows Server 2012
Windows Server 2012 R2

Windows Server 2016

Monday, 19 June 2017

Nutanix ECP Administration (5.0) Course - Part 1

As mentioned previously on my blog post Nutanix Certification - My next steps, I have started down my next IT certification path with the Nutanix Platform Professional (NPP).

My training for this will involve getting hands-on with both Nutanix CE in my home lab and our Nutanix Cluster at work, as well as completing online Nutanix training. I have also found that others have also used the Nutanix Bible as well as the YouTube channel to supplement the training.

The first training course that I have started is the Nutanix ECP Administration (5.0) course. This course is available online for free by creating a account and requesting access by email to

The course consists of five modules which have to be taken in order. Once you complete a module the next one is unlocked. The course also has a consolidation lab as well as the NPP 5.0 exam.

To pass the exam it is recommended to complete the course as well as study the following Nutanix Technical Publications:-

  • Nutanix Command Reference Guide
  • Nutanix Setup Guide
  • Nutanix Web Console Guide
The exam consists of a random set of 50 multiple-choice questions. You are allowed a maximum of two hours to complete the exam and can attempt to pass the exam 3 times. The pass mark is 80 %.

The five modules in the course are:-
  1. Introducing the Nutanix Enterprise Cloud Platform
  2. Administering the Nutanix Cluster
  3. Getting to Know Acropolis
  4. Getting to Know Prism
  5. Maintaining the Nutanix Cluster
The first module is split into two parts, the Nutanix Product Family and Nutanix Enterprise Cloud. The module is in the format of slide shows or short videos with questions to confirm and consolidate your learning.

The Nutanix Product Family section introduces you to Nutanix, the hardware and license management. 

The Nutanix Enterprise Cloud section gives you an overview of the Nutanix platform, Cluster components (Zeus, Zookeeper, Medusa, Cassandra, Stargate, Curator, Prism). Again this section has consolidation questions.

Once completed, the next module (Administering the Nutanix Cluster) is then unlocked....

I will post more information about the subsequent modules as and when I complete them.

Friday, 16 June 2017

Nutanix Certification - My next steps

I have recently been thinking about what technical certification I should do next. It needs to be something that will enhance my IT career, as well as provide me something new to learn.

At work we are in the process of deploying a Nutanix Hyper-converged platform, so I thought that it would be a good chance for me to gain new skills on this platform as well as looking into any associated certifications that I could look into gaining along the way.

Nutanix has several technical professional certifications that individuals can gain to prove their skills:-

NPP – Nutanix Platform Professional Certification “confirms your ability to install, configure, and manage the Nutanix environment

NSS – Nutanix Support Specialist Certification “verifies the skills necessary to provide Level 1& 2 support for a Nutanix cluster

NPX – Nutanix Platform Expert Certification “peer-vetted, hypervisor agnostic certification designed for veteran solution engineers, consultants, and architects

You can find out more about each of these certification as well as the three sales related certifications on the Nutanix website.

In my case I have decided to start with the NPP certification. To get started with this you need to create an account at and then email to request access to the free online training. This will then get you access to the Nutanix ECP Administration (5.0) course along with many other Nutanix educational resources.

The nice thing about the training and the exam is that Nutanix have made all of this available for free!

Thank you Nutanix!

I will post more about this as I progress through my training to the exam.